Интерфейс ISearchCrawlScopeManager (searchapi.h)
Предоставляет методы, уведомляющие поисковую систему о том, что контейнеры должны сканировать и (или) watch, а также элементы в этих контейнерах для включения или исключения при обходе контента или просмотре.
Наследование
Интерфейс ISearchCrawlScopeManager наследуется от интерфейса IUnknown . ISearchCrawlScopeManager также имеет следующие типы членов:
Методы
Интерфейс ISearchCrawlScopeManager содержит следующие методы.
ISearchCrawlScopeManager::AddDefaultScopeRule Добавляет URL-адрес в качестве область по умолчанию для этого правила. |
ISearchCrawlScopeManager::AddHierarchicalScope Добавляет иерархическую область в поисковую систему. |
ISearchCrawlScopeManager::AddRoot Добавляет новый корень поиска в поисковую систему. |
ISearchCrawlScopeManager::AddUserScopeRule Добавляет новое правило обхода область, когда пользователь создает новое правило или добавляет URL-адрес для индексирования. |
ISearchCrawlScopeManager::EnumerateRoots Возвращает перечисление всех корней, о которых известно этому экземпляру ISearchCrawlScopeManager. |
ISearchCrawlScopeManager::EnumerateScopeRules Возвращает перечисление всех область правил, о которых знает данный экземпляр интерфейса ISearchCrawlScopeManager. |
ISearchCrawlScopeManager::GetParentScopeVersionId Возвращает идентификатор версии URL-адреса родительского включения. |
ISearchCrawlScopeManager::HasChildScopeRule Определяет, имеет ли данный URL-адрес дочернее правило в область. |
ISearchCrawlScopeManager::HasParentScopeRule Определяет, имеет ли данный URL-адрес родительское правило в область. |
ISearchCrawlScopeManager::IncludedInCrawlScope Получает индикатор включения указанного URL-адреса в область обхода контента. |
ISearchCrawlScopeManager::IncludedInCrawlScopeEx Извлекает индикатор того, включен ли указанный URL-адрес в область обхода. |
ISearchCrawlScopeManager::RemoveDefaultScopeRule Удаляет правило область по умолчанию из поисковой системы. |
ISearchCrawlScopeManager::RemoveRoot Удаляет корень поиска из поисковой системы. |
ISearchCrawlScopeManager::RemoveScopeRule Удаляет правило область из поисковой системы. |
ISearchCrawlScopeManager::RevertToDefaultScopes Возвращается к областям по умолчанию. |
ISearchCrawlScopeManager::SaveAll Фиксирует все изменения в поисковой системе. |
Комментарии
Пример, демонстрирующий определение параметров командной строки для операций индексирования в диспетчере области обхода контента (CSM), см. в примере CrawlScopeCommandLine .
Требования
Требование | Значение |
---|---|
Минимальная версия клиента | Windows XP с пакетом обновления 2 (SP2), Windows Vista [только классические приложения] |
Минимальная версия сервера | Windows Server 2003 с пакетом обновления 1 (SP1) [только классические приложения] |
Целевая платформа | Windows |
Header | searchapi.h |
Распространяемые компоненты | Windows Desktop Search (WDS) 3.0 |
См. также раздел
Основные понятия